Seamlessly integrate development and operations processes to enhance collaboration, accelerate delivery and maintain quality in application development.
The OpenEdge DevOps Framework (OEDF) is designed to facilitate the seamless integration of development and operations activities throughout the software development lifecycle.
Its core principles include leveraging automation tools and practices to streamline repetitive tasks, such as building, testing and deployment. The DevOps framework also focuses on fostering close cooperation between development, operations and other stakeholders to drive alignment and shared responsibility. Additionally, it embraces a culture of constant improvement through feedback loops, monitoring and iterative enhancements.
The OpenEdge DevOps Framework comprises several key components, each serving a specific role in the development and delivery process:
Automating the build and integration process to detect errors early.
Enabling automated testing to maintain product quality and reliability.
Automating the deployment process to promote rapid and reliable releases.
The adoption of the OpenEdge DevOps Framework offers numerous benefits to organizations seeking to modernize their development practices and enhance their competitiveness:
Accelerated Delivery
The OpenEdge DevOps Framework automates critical aspects of the development and deployment process so organizations can release software updates more quickly and frequently, reducing time to market and keeping pace with evolving customer demands.
Improved Quality
Automated testing and continuous integration practices embedded within the framework help identify and address defects early in the development cycle, leading to higher product quality and greater customer satisfaction.
Enhanced Collaboration
The framework promotes collaboration and communication among development, operations and other cross-functional teams, fostering a culture of shared responsibility and collective ownership of the software delivery process.
Increased Efficiency
The OpenEdge DevOps Framework optimizes resource utilization, minimizes downtime and maximizes productivity across the development lifecycle by streamlining workflows and reducing the need for manual intervention.